Patent number: 11761849Abstract: A wind tunnel for a motor vehicle, with a fan, a test section, through which an air stream generated by the fan can flow, a recording device for recording different motor vehicles within the test section, and a testing device for determining aerodynamic characteristics of the motor vehicle. The wind tunnel also includes an optical sensing device for sensing an outer contour of the motor vehicle recorded by the recording device, an evaluating unit and a linking unit. The evaluating unit determines a vehicle configuration from the outer contour of the motor vehicle sensed by the optical sensing device. The linking unit links the vehicle configuration of the motor vehicle determined by the evaluating unit with the test results determined by the testing device.Type: GrantFiled: December 20, 2021Date of Patent: September 19, 2023Inventors: Tim Kayser, Marcel Straub, Jan-Niklas Helbach, Matthias Braun, Jin Gong

Publication number: 20220242986Abstract: A shape memory resin includes a polymer comprising 64-85 mol % N-alkylacrylamide component, 14-35 mol % acrylic ester component, and 0.01-6 mol % crosslinking component.Type: ApplicationFiled: May 27, 2020Publication date: August 4, 2022Applicant: Shiseido Company, Ltd.Inventors: Atsushi SOGABE, Chunming WEN, Jin GONG

Patent number: 11148123Abstract: Disclosed is a catalyst for producing the olefin. The catalyst includes a support including alumina and a sub-support component, and a metal oxide impregnated on the support. The metal oxide includes anyone selected from an oxide of chromium, vanadium, manganese, iron, cobalt, molybdenum, copper, zinc, cerium and nickel; and the sub-support component includes anyone selected from zirconium, zinc and platinum.Type: GrantFiled: December 28, 2017Date of Patent: October 19, 2021Assignees: SK GAS CO., LTD., KOREA RESEARCH INSTITUTE OF CHEMICAL TECHNOLOGYInventors: Won Choon Choi, Yong Ki Park, Su Jin Gong, Seo Hyun Shim, Deuk Soo Park, Ung Gi Hong
